Bruschetta Breaded Chicken
This Bruschetta Breaded Chicken starts with a summery bruschetta made from plump cherry tomatoes, fresh basil, garlic, and a splash of olive oil and balsamic vinegar that is paired with a piece of crunchy oven-baked breaded chicken on a bed of spaghetti.

Bruschetta
- 2 c cherry tomatoes, halved
- ⅓ c fresh basil, thinly sliced
- 1 garlic clove
- 1 T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 1 Tbsp balsamic vinegar
- salt, to taste
- black pepper, to taste
Breaded Chicken and Spaghetti
- 16 oz spaghetti
- 1 lb chicken tenders, trimmed
- ½ c whole wheat panko breadcrumbs
- ¼ c unbleached all-purpose flour
- 1 egg or egg white
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 1 tsp dried parsley
- ¼ tsp cayenne pepper
- ¼ tsp salt
- ⅛ tsp black pepper
Bruschetta
Cut cherry tomatoes in half. Mince garlic. Slice basil into thin ribbons. Combine in medium bowl. Toss with olive oil and balsamic vinegar. Season with salt and pepper, to taste.
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ate until ready to serve.
Breaded Chicken and Spaghetti
Preheat oven to 425°F.
Combine bread crumbs, paprika, onion powder, garlic powder, parsley, cayenne pepper, and salt and pepper in a shallow dish. Set aside.
Combine egg or egg white and a few tablespoons of water in a separate dish to create the egg white wash. Set aside.
Add flour to a third dish. Set aside.
Dredge chicken in flour. Then toss in egg wash. Coat with breadcrumbs. Turn the chicken over in breadcrumbs several times until well coated. Transfer to a baking sheet.
Cook chicken 15 to 17 minutes, or until breading is golden brown and chicken is cooked through. Remove from oven.
While the chicken is baking, bring a large stock pot of water to a boil. Add spaghetti and cook 6 to 8 minutes, or until al dente. Drain and coat lightly with olive oil. Set aside.
Portion out spaghetti onto plates. Top with a piece of crispy chicken. Spoon a generous amount of bruschetta on top of chicken. Enjoy!
